The article reports that Mexico has unveiled a national plan to combat sargassum seaweed, which is costing the country significant economic damage. The plan is funded with $158 million and aims to address the growing issue of sargassum accumulation along coastal areas. While the focus is on environmental management and local impact, the article highlights the scale of the problem and the financial commitment by the Mexican government.
